The need for better decentralized stablecoins has been emphasized, focusing on three primary challenges: finding a superior index to track beyond the USD, designing a decentralized oracle system resistant to capture, and addressing the competition posed by staking yields. While tracking the USD is currently practical, long-term resilience requires independence from potential USD hyperinflation.
A decentralized oracle system must ensure that the cost of capture exceeds the protocol token market cap, avoiding high user costs. Additionally, the competition from staking yields needs resolution, with potential solutions including reducing staking yields to hobbyist levels, creating a new staking category with high yields but lower slashing risks, or integrating slashable staking with collateral usability. These challenges highlight the complexities in developing stablecoins that are both secure and economically viable.
